@charset "gb2312";
body {color: #000;font-size: 12px;margin:0 auto;line-height:20px; background: url(images/bg01.jpg) top repeat-x #B4D7D9;}/*  主体定义 */
ul,p,div,form,h1,h2,h3,h5,td,table,dl,dt,dd,li{margin:0px;padding:0px;}/*重置标签样式*/
li{list-style-type: none;}/*去掉标签*/
img a{ border:0;}
/*--------------默认链接样式---------------*/
A:link,A:visited {color: #000; text-decoration: none}
A:hover,a:hover { color: #f00; text-decoration: none; }
/*--------------红色链接样式---------------*/
a.red:link,a.red:visited {color: #ff0; text-decoration: none; }
a.red:active ,a.red:hover { color: #00f; text-decoration: underline; }
/*--------------黑色链接样式---------------*/
a.black:link,a.black:visited {color: #000; text-decoration: none; }
a.black:active ,a.black:hover { color: #00f; text-decoration: underline; }
.gray{color:#be9400;}/*定义灰色*/
.black{ color:#000;}/*定义黑色*/
.red{ color:#f00;}/*定义红色*/
.clear{clear:both}
h1{ font-size:14px; color:#000;}/*标题１重定义*/
.mainframe{margin:0 auto;  width:1000px;}/*主体框*/
.mtit{position:absolute;text-indent: -5000px;}/*隐藏文本*/
.content{ padding:5px 10px 5px 10px; line-height:27px;}/*内容时使用*/
.imgbox{ border:1px solid #999; padding:5px;}/*图片加边框*/
.bg{background-repeat:repeat-x; background-position:bottom}/*背景*/
.more{position:absolute;right: 30px;bottom:0px;float:right;}/*更多时使用，使用时上一级标签要用position:relative;*/
.tit14{font-size:14px;}  /*特殊定义14像素字体*/
.b{ font-weight:bold;}
/*表格默认灰色框-------使用这个时候表格里不能包含表格-------*/
.mytable{border-collapse: collapse;}
.mytable td {padding:0px;border: 1px solid #3b9acb;}
/*新闻样子*/
.main_news {padding:5px 0px 5px 0px;}
.main_news li{ background:url(images/dot01.gif) left center no-repeat; padding-left:15px; height:30px; line-height:30px; position:relative; }
/*产品及图片样式*/
.show{margin:5px;width:100%; padding-left:20px;}
.show li{list-style-type: none;width:190px;height:140px;float:left;padding:13px;text-align:center;line-height:25px;}
.show img{border:1px #888 solid;padding:2px;margin:1px;background-color:#ffffff;}
.show .nav{ clear:both; text-align:center; padding-top:10px;}
/*PNG透时图片时使用*/
.png{ width: 1px;height: 1px;fil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(src="images/pic.JPG",sizingMethod="image");}
/*滚动图片时使用*/
#marquee1{  width:912px; overflow:hidden;}
#marquee1 img{ margin-right:15px; border:1px solid #7eb3b6;}
/*加警察用*/
#footerinner{position:relative; text-align:center;}
#cyberpolice{position:absolute; right:30px; top:-10px;}
.lineb{ border-bottom:1px dashed #0099FF;}
/*浮动*/
.fl{ float:left};
.fr { float:right;}
/*内容新闻列表*/
#news_title { text-align:center; font-size:18px;}
.content_list{ width:600px; padding:10px 10px 10px 10px;}
.content_list li{ background:url(images/dot01.gif) left center no-repeat; padding-left:15px; height:30px; line-height:30px; position:relative;}
.content_list li span{ color:#666666; position:absolute; right:10px;}
.content_list .nav{ width:550px; clear:both; text-align:center; padding-top:10px;}
#news_title h1{ padding:5px; font-weight:bold; font-size:16px;}

/*内容新闻列表*/
.content_list01{ width:710px; padding:10px 10px 10px 10px;}
.content_list01 li{ background:url(images/dot01.gif) left center no-repeat; padding-left:15px; height:30px; line-height:30px; position:relative; border-bottom:1px dashed  #3366FF;}
.content_list01 li span{ color:#666666; position:absolute; right:20px; }
.content_list01 .nav{ width:550px; clear:both; text-align:center; padding-top:10px;}
.content_list01 a:visited{ color:#FF6600;}
.content_list01{}

.wrap { margin:0 auto; }
.wrap_content{ margin:0 auto; width:1000px;}
/*导航*/
.nav { width:884px; height:59px; padding:0 58px 0 58px;}
.nav_list { width:125px; height:59px; float:left; margin-right:22px;}
/*中间内容*/
.con { width:984px; padding:0 8px 0 8px;}
/*首页左边*/
.left { width:225px; height:606px; background:#FFFFFF; padding:0 10px 0 10px;}
.right { width:716px; height:601px; background:#f6f5ef; padding:5px 8px 0 8px;}
/*底部*/
.bottom{ width:1000px; height:84px;padding-top:10px; float:left;}
.bottom_txt { width:650px; text-align:right; float:left; margin-right:20px; margin-top:15px;}
.bottom a:link,.bottom a:visited {color: #000; text-decoration: none}
.bottom a:hover,.bottom a:hover { color: #FF0000; text-decoration: none; }

/*片头样式*/
.index { text-align:center; color:#000;}
.index a:link,.index a:visited {color: #000; text-decoration: none}
.index a:hover,.index a:hover { color: #FF0000; text-decoration: none; }
/*会员注册*/
.member { width:206px; height:108px; border-left:1px solid #a3c8cb;border-right:1px solid #a3c8cb; padding-left:17px;}
.member_box { width:132px; height:18px; border:1px solid #a3c8cb; background:#e3fdff; float:left; margin-top:9px;}
.member_btn { width:50px; height:19px; background:url(images/member_btn.jpg) no-repeat; line-height:19px; text-align:center; float:left; margin-top:18px; margin-left:30px; display:inline;}
.member_btn a:link,.member_btn a:visited {color: #FFFFFF; text-decoration: none}
.member_btn a:hover,.member_btn a:hover { color: #ffffff; text-decoration: none; }
/*站内搜索*/
.search01 { width:220px; height:48px; background:#a3c8cb; padding:0 0 0 5px;}
.search_box { width:131px; height:29px; color:#adadad;font-size:14px; font-weight:bold;  line-height:29px; padding:0 3px 0 3px; background:url(images/search_box.jpg) no-repeat; float:left; margin-top:9px;}
.search_txt { width:45px;  font-weight:bold; height:29px; float:left; margin-top:9px; padding:0px;}
/*首页文章*/
.article { width:473px; height:142px; background:#fff; border:1px solid #c7a684; margin-bottom:6px;}
.article_img { width:163px; height:137px; text-align:center; float:left; padding-top:5px;}
.article_txt { width:310px; height:137px; float:left; padding-top:5px;}
.article_title { font-family:Microsoft YaHei,黑体,Airal; color:#4444ee; font-size:16px; margin-bottom:10px;}
.article_more { font-size:14px; text-align:right;}
.article_more a:link,.article_more a:visited {color: #cd0000; text-decoration: none}
.article_more a:hover,.article_more a:hover { color: #FF0000; text-decoration: none; }
/*公告栏*/
.notice { width:218px; height:250px;background:#fff;border-left:1px solid #a3c8cb;border-right:1px solid #a3c8cb; padding-left:14px; padding-top:5px;}
.notice li { width:203px; height:30px; line-height:30px; background:url(images/notice_li.jpg) bottom repeat-x;}
/*最新留言*/
.book {width:218px; height:258px;background:#fff;border-left:1px solid #a3c8cb;border-right:1px solid #a3c8cb; padding-left:14px; padding-top:15px;}
.book li { width:182px; height:30px; line-height:30px; background:url(images/book_li.jpg) bottom repeat-x; padding-left:15px;}
/*图片样式*/
.image_list { width:962px; height:120px; background:url(images/image_bg.jpg) repeat-x;border-left:1px solid #7eb3b6;border-right:1px solid #7eb3b6; padding: 5px 10px 0 10px;}
/*友情链接*/
.link { width:832; background:url(images/link_bg.jpg) repeat-x; height:51px; line-height:46px; padding-left:20px;}
/*子页01*/
.left01 { width:225px;  background:#FFFFFF; padding:0 10px 0 10px;}
.right01 { width:716px;  background:#f6f5ef; padding:5px 8px 0 8px;}
.sub_title { width:690px; height:30px; font-size:14px; color:#003439; font-family:Microsoft YaHei,黑体,Airal; background:url(images/title_bg.jpg) bottom  repeat-x; line-height:30px; padding-left:26px;}
.sub_title tr td{ height:30px; line-height:30px;}
/*天盘地盘子页*/
.left02 { width:194px;  background:#FFFFFF; border:1px solid #77c2e5; padding:1px;}
.right02 { width:774px;  background:#FFFFFF; border:1px solid #77c2e5;padding:1px;}
.left_title { width:194px; height:37px; background:#b3e7ff; text-align:center; line-height:37px; color:#00266d; font-size:16px; font-weight:bold;}
.sub_title01 { width:774px; height:37px;background:#b3e7ff;line-height:37px; color:#00266d; font-size:16px; font-weight:bold;}
.sub_title01_txt01 { float:left; width:530px; padding-left:50px;}
.sub_title01_txt02 {float:left; width:144px; padding-right:50px; font-size:13px;}
#yangxu{background:url(images/bottom_pic.png); width:57px; height:57px;}

.sub_txt { width:754px; padding-left:20px; line-height:30px;}
.sub_txt01 { width:686px; padding:15px;line-height:30px;}
.hits li{ width:45%; float:left;}

.piaofu {
    width: 180px;
    position: fixed;
    bottom: 20%;
}
.piaofu img {
    width: 100%;
}